BBB Wisconsin Accreditation Annual Fee

1 - 9 employees:           $545
10 - 20 employees:       $655
21 - 50 employees:       $745
51 - 100 employees:      $965
101 - 200 employees:    $1,095
201 - 300 employees:   $1,205
301 - 500 employees:   $1,515
Affiliate Businesses:      $295

Additional Location: $60
Monthly Payment Plan: +$5/month

Corporate Community Partner Program

For any business, especially those over 500 employees, BBB offers additional benefits through the Corporate Community Partner Program. For more information and pricing, contact partner@wisconsin.bbb.org.

NOTE: Accreditation fee structure is based on a one-time annual payment.

Accreditation fees vary depending upon monthly and other payment options. This list does not include mandatory EFT fees for monthly payments.
